这段时间一直在用Android Studio做一些Demo的开发,一开始从Eclipse中转向这个开发工具,各种不适应,希望此博文可以一直更新,还有网友可以分享出自己方便更好更快开发的一些技巧。
首先我讲一些经常用到的快捷键吧,网上很多都只说一个大概,很模糊,也不知道什么时候才会用到。我们尽量让这篇博文有作用而不是纯粹的Copy吧!
虽然说Android Studio可以直接一键把所有快捷键设置成Eclipse的快捷键,但是想到你身边的同事,有可能不一定会设置成Eclipse,这样有的时候你如果用别人的电脑,每次都要调一下,也比较麻烦,倒不如平时就用Android Studio的快捷键。
0.Android Studio快捷键沿用Eclipse的快捷键(不推荐)
1.设置鼠标移到类上面会有说明出现(跟Eclipse对应)。(进入设置界面:File->Settings)
效果图:
2.快捷键Alt+Enter.(自动导包,还有提示一些错误的解决方法【如需要加try catch什么的,会提示】)
转载请注明出处: http://blog.csdn.net/ljphhj
3.快捷键Alt+Insert.(快速生成构造函数,getter/setter方法,toString(), equals()和hashCode() 等)【相当于Eclipse中的Alt+Shift+S】
4.另一个比较重要的快捷键就是跳到上一步的位置(Ctrl+Alt+方向左键),跳到下一步的位置(Ctrl+Alt+方向右键)
这个快捷键,在你跟踪代码的时候,非常的好用,有的时候你一直按着(Ctrl+鼠标点击类),一直往源码里面跳,之后不记得自己是从哪里跳进来的了。这两个快捷键就是帮你更好地退回和前进的。
5.智能提示的时候忽略大小写问题(比如:String类, 你打string也可以提示你String),把此处设置成None
还有智能提示的快捷键在Android Studio中是Ctrl+空格(跟输入法的冲突),你可以自己把它改成Alt+/跟Eclipse的一样。
6.智能缩写模板(Live Template),Ctrl + J
相信用Eclipse的人,经常会用sysout 然后按一下 Alt+/来输出System.out.println();这样一行代码
在Android Studio中也是有的,按Ctrl + J快捷键可以看到一些,比如:psvm是生成一个
public static void main(String[] args)函数块的,那么我们如果想设置这个main函数块跟Eclipse中一样的话,也可以
7.修改或添加Live Templates
8.智能格式化代码(帮助排版代码的格式,看起来更舒服一些!): Alt+Ctrl+L
9.蛋碎的自动提示,你打一个字母,他就提示,烦的要死。
(持续更新,希望有知道更多好用的技巧的网友,可以留言!都是苦逼程序猿,互相帮助,节约我们的开发时间)
转载请注明出处: http://blog.csdn.net/ljphhj